This collection by Lindy Warrell has no pretensions other than to invite readers to dance to the tune of a curious mix of words held together by the absence of form: free verse. Each poem strikes a mood with variations from serious or dark to light and funny. Some are wise, others nonsensical with the overall aim to entertain.

Autorenporträt
Lindy Warrell is a novelist, blogger, and poet with a PhD in anthropology from The University of Adelaide. Her debut novel, The Publican's Daughter, was published in 2022. She has edited two poetry collections in collaboration, and her poems appear in three chapbooks, online and in literary journals. A publican's daughter and mother of three, Lindy lived in Post-War Japan as a child, travelled in South Asia, did postgraduate field research in Sri Lanka, and has worked as an anthropologist across outback Australia.
